Industry-Specific Drivers: Key growth catalysts include: **Defense & Aerospace:** Increasing demand for lightweight armor, missile components, and thermal protection systems leveraging nano boron carbide’s exceptional hardness and low density. **Electronics & Semiconductor:** Utilization in high-performance substrates, wear-resistant coatings, and thermal management solutions. **Cutting Tools & Wear-Resistant Components:** Adoption of nano B4C for extending tool life and enhancing precision. **Emerging Applications:** Biomedical devices, nuclear shielding, and environmental remediation where nanostructured boron carbide offers unique advantages. Technological Advancements: Innovations in nanoparticle synthesis, surface functionalization, and composite integration are reducing costs and enhancing performance, thus expanding application horizons. Key Product Categories **Nano Boron Carbide Powders:** Primary raw material, produced via carbothermic reduction or chemical vapor deposition (CVD). **Nano-Structured Boron Carbide Composites:** Integrated into ceramics, coatings, and composites for enhanced properties. **Functionalized Nano B4C:** Surface-modified particles tailored for specific applications like biomedical or electronic uses. Cost Structures, Pricing Strategies, & Investment Patterns Manufacturing nano B4C involves significant capital expenditure on high-temperature furnaces, CVD reactors, and surface modification equipment. Raw material costs are influenced by global boron and carbon markets, with prices averaging around $50–$70 per kg for high-purity powders. Pricing strategies are typically value-based, reflecting performance advantages and application criticality. Premium pricing is common in defense and aerospace sectors, where performance margins justify higher margins. Operating margins for specialized nano B4C producers range from 15–25% , contingent on scale and technological differentiation. Adoption Trends & End-User Insights Defense and aerospace sectors are leading adopters, leveraging nano B4C for lightweight armor, missile nose cones, and thermal barriers. The electronics industry is integrating nano boron carbide into high-performance substrates and thermal interface materials, driven by miniaturization trends. Emerging consumption patterns include increased use in biomedical implants due to biocompatibility and corrosion resistance, and in environmental remediation for catalytic applications.
